Dr. Richard Fogarty discussing the role of racism in German protests against the role of French colonial troops in the occupation of the Rhineland. The usage of the troops from North Africa was also protested in other nations around the world. #WW1Symposium

“But I do beg that in the act of remembering that… we should also make the extra effort of at least trying to understand, because if we don’t, it seems to me that we are robbing those dead men of their due.” (John Terraine, 1983 address to Western Front Association)
